/**
* CarFacetButtons placed on the nav bar are designed to have visual indication that the active
* application on screen is associated with it. This is basically a similar concept to a radio
* button group.
*/

/**
* This will unselect the currently selected CarFacetButton and determine which one should be
* selected next. It does this by reading the properties on the CarFacetButton and seeing if
* they are a match with the supplied StackInfo list.
* The order of selection detection is ComponentName, PackageName then Category
* They will then be compared with the supplied StackInfo list.
* The StackInfo is expected to be supplied in order of recency and StackInfo will only be used
* for consideration if it has the same displayId as the CarFacetButtons.
* @param taskInfo of the currently running application
*/
public void taskChanged(List<ActivityManager.StackInfo> stackInfoList) {
int displayId = getDisplayId();
for (ActivityManager.StackInfo stackInfo :stackInfoList) {
// if the display id is known and does not match the stack we skip
if (displayId != -1 && displayId != stackInfo.displayId ||
stackInfo.topActivity == null) {
continue;
}
if (mSelectedFacetButton != null) {
mSelectedFacetButton.setSelected(false);
}
String packageName = stackInfo.topActivity.getPackageName();
CarFacetButton facetButton = findFacetButtongByComponentName(stackInfo.topActivity);
if (facetButton == null) {
facetButton = mButtonsByPackage.get(packageName);
}
if (facetButton == null) {
String category = getPackageCategory(packageName);
if (category != null) {
facetButton = mButtonsByCategory.get(category);
}
}
if (facetButton != null) {
facetButton.setSelected(true);
mSelectedFacetButton = facetButton;
return;
}
}
}
